Mental Health Implications
Impact on Viewers
Exposure to distressing content like the Lil Jeff death video can have severe mental health consequences. Studies show that viewing traumatic material can lead to anxiety, depression, and post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D).
Health professionals recommend limiting exposure to such content and seeking support if affected. Organizations like the National Alliance on Mental Illness (NAMI) offer resources for individuals in need.
Legal Ramifications
The dissemination of unauthorized videos depicting someone's death raises legal concerns. In many jurisdictions, sharing such content without consent is illegal and can result in criminal charges.
Law enforcement agencies are increasingly cracking down on individuals and organizations involved in spreading harmful content. This reflects a growing recognition of the need for legal frameworks to address digital-age challenges.
